Operant Conditioning
A method for behavior enhancement or reduction through the strategic use of reinforcement or punishment.
Aggressive Models
Reference to individuals or representations that exhibit aggressive behaviors, which may then be imitated by observers, according to social learning theory.
Albert Bandura
A psychologist known for his work on social learning theory and the concept of self-efficacy.
Discrimination
The unfair or biased treatment of various groups, particularly based on their race, age, gender, or disabilities.
